Dogecoin Trading Volume Plummets 25% as 2025 Ends, Major Payment Initiatives Teased for 2026

Dogecoin (DOGE) concluded 2025 with a significant drop in market activity, as its 24-hour trading volume fell by 25% to approximately $682 million, according to data from CoinMarketCap. This decline mirrors a broader slowdown across the cryptocurrency market during the holiday season, with on-chain analytics platform Santiment noting that Bitcoin and altcoins have seen their lowest trading volumes in the second half of December compared to the same period in 2024.

Despite the volume crash, Dogecoin's price has remained remarkably stable, trading in a tight range between $0.1213 and $0.1275 since December 27. Market momentum indicators have flattened, with the Relative Strength Index (RSI) stagnating at a level of 37, suggesting a slight bearish sentiment. Analysts indicate this tight consolidation could precede a significant price move, with potential resistance levels at $0.146 and $0.195, and support near $0.09.

Looking ahead, Dogecoin's corporate arm, House of Doge, has teased major developments slated for 2026. The initiatives focus on expanding Dogecoin's utility as a payment method. Plans include the rollout of B2B and B2C payment solutions starting in Q1 2026, featuring a rewards debit card usable at over 150 million merchants globally. Additional tools for merchants, such as embeddable wallets and enterprise acceptance solutions, are also in the pipeline. The organization also expects to announce partnerships with leading industry players in the coming months, signaling a continued push for mainstream adoption despite current market lethargy.
